The information within the LP5569 datasheet typically includes sections such as absolute maximum ratings (the limits beyond which the device may be damaged), recommended operating conditions, electrical characteristics (voltage, current, power consumption), timing diagrams, application examples, and package information. Understanding these sections is crucial. For instance, the “absolute maximum ratings” tell you the absolute boundaries for voltage and current that the LP5569 can endure before permanent damage occurs. Exceeding these limits, even for a short time, is a recipe for disaster. Similarly, the “recommended operating conditions” outline the range within which the device is guaranteed to perform according to its specifications. Operating outside of this range might lead to unpredictable or degraded performance. The typical breakdown of a data sheet is often as follows:
